12 university students denied bail again

The students have been arrested cases of vandalism and attacks on police  

Update : 16 Aug 2018, 02:22 PM

A Dhaka court has again rejected the bail pleas of 12 private university students in two cases filed over vandalism and attacks on police during movements for safer roads.

Metropolitan Magistrate Laskar Sohel Rana issued the order on Thursday after hearing the bail petitions.

The students are - Shakhawat Hossain Nijhum, Shihab Shahriar, Saber Ahmed Ullash, Azizur Rahman Antar, Rashedul Islam, Md Hasan, Mushfikur Rahman, Redwan Ahmed, Reza Rifat Ahmed, Shimanta Sarker and Iftekher Hossain.

As many as 22 private university students, arrested in these two cases by the Badda and Bhatara police stations, were denied bail repeatedly.

Earlier in the week, the court denied bail to 12 of them.

Students of several private universities clashed with police, early this month, while demonstrating against attacks on students during their movement for safe roads in the city.
